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							0b80a56294 
							
						 
					 
					
						
						
							
							External test for Gnosis Protocol v2  
						
						
						
					 
					
						2022-06-08 20:23:39 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							5c76d8ee77 
							
						 
					 
					
						
						
							
							External test for Chainlink  
						
						
						
					 
					
						2022-06-08 20:21:58 +02:00 
						 
				 
			
				
					
						
							
							
								nishant-sachdeva 
							
						 
					 
					
						
						
						
						
							
						
						
							61306a6f9d 
							
						 
					 
					
						
						
							
							disabling more zeppline tests that expect reverts with specific errors and they're broken via IR due to Hardhat heuristics.  
						
						... 
						
						
						
						Updated zeppelin.sh
Added cautionary comment for two sed commands that depend on the order of occurrence of the patterns in the files.
L122, and L123 both are referencing the 3rd occurrence of the patterns from their respective files.
This could result in an error in the future when the code is further modified. 
						
					 
					
						2022-06-06 19:15:40 +05:30 
						 
				 
			
				
					
						
							
							
								Matheus Aguiar 
							
						 
					 
					
						
						
						
						
							
						
						
							3904a0d5ce 
							
						 
					 
					
						
						
							
							Revert workaround introduced in euler tests because it is no longer needed.  
						
						... 
						
						
						
						This reverts commit 98efb46031 
						
					 
					
						2022-05-31 09:00:00 -03: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							1543cfc904 
							
						 
					 
					
						
						
							
							Merge pull request  #13067  from ethereum/disable-zeppelin-test-cases-failing-after-relaxing-inlining  
						
						... 
						
						
						
						Disable more zeppelin test cases in which Hardhat's heuristics break after relaxing inlining. 
						
					 
					
						2022-05-25 23:04:05 +02:00 
						 
				 
			
				
					
						
							
							
								Matheus Aguiar 
							
						 
					 
					
						
						
						
						
							
						
						
							be12f90775 
							
						 
					 
					
						
						
							
							Disable zeppelin test cases in which Hardhat's heuristics break after relaxing inilining.  
						
						... 
						
						
						
						Also disabled one test because of hardhat issue 2115 (revert due to overflow misdetected). 
						
					 
					
						2022-05-25 16:24:18 -03: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							c8612078c4 
							
						 
					 
					
						
						
							
							Remove the ethers.js 5.6.2 workaround from all ext tests except for gnosis and uniswap  
						
						
						
					 
					
						2022-05-25 16:20:49 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							6937799587 
							
						 
					 
					
						
						
							
							gnosis: Pin typescript dependency at <= 4.7.0  
						
						
						
					 
					
						2022-05-25 15:52:21 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							49d5c0a292 
							
						 
					 
					
						
						
							
							Disable external test cases where Hardhat's heuristics break after relaxing inlining  
						
						
						
					 
					
						2022-05-23 13:37:36 +02:00 
						 
				 
			
				
					
						
							
							
								Matheus Aguiar 
							
						 
					 
					
						
						
						
						
							
						
						
							98efb46031 
							
						 
					 
					
						
						
							
							Patches issue  https://github.com/euler-xyz/euler-contracts/issues/119 .  
						
						... 
						
						
						
						After issue is resolved, this should be reverted/changed. 
						
					 
					
						2022-05-23 11:26:50 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							3f4d9cb035 
							
						 
					 
					
						
						
							
							Disable more external tests failing due to Hardhat heuristics  
						
						
						
					 
					
						2022-05-20 15:59:57 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							54c5b3de68 
							
						 
					 
					
						
						
							
							Re-enable the optimized IR preset in all external tests  
						
						
						
					 
					
						2022-05-20 14:50:57 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							1164d1b4dd 
							
						 
					 
					
						
						
							
							Switch ENS external test to master branch  
						
						
						
					 
					
						2022-05-17 13:02:12 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							27e5afa23d 
							
						 
					 
					
						
						
							
							Patch external tests for the override data alignment issue until our patches are accepted upstream  
						
						
						
					 
					
						2022-05-17 13:02:12 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							adf3eaac9b 
							
						 
					 
					
						
						
							
							gnosis: Update upstream repo URL  
						
						
						
					 
					
						2022-05-17 10:57:21 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							c57bc47060 
							
						 
					 
					
						
						
							
							gnosis: Disable newly added tests broken due to Hardhat heuristics  
						
						
						
					 
					
						2022-05-17 10:57:21 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							91177d74ee 
							
						 
					 
					
						
						
							
							perpetual-pools: Remove the ethers@5.6.1 workaround  
						
						
						
					 
					
						2022-05-16 20:52:53 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							e9f1bd00cc 
							
						 
					 
					
						
						
							
							gnosis: Workaround for problems caused by forcing ethers@5.6.1 in external tests  
						
						
						
					 
					
						2022-05-16 20:52:30 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							3bfb79df0c 
							
						 
					 
					
						
						
							
							gnosis: Workaround for getStorageAt() bug in Hardhat 2.9.5  
						
						
						
					 
					
						2022-05-13 19:05:21 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							8e085432bb 
							
						 
					 
					
						
						
							
							External test for Brink  
						
						
						
					 
					
						2022-04-13 13:43:48 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							e30d0a6199 
							
						 
					 
					
						
						
							
							externalTests: Allow adding extra settings to presets  
						
						
						
					 
					
						2022-04-13 13:43:48 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							73443c0ada 
							
						 
					 
					
						
						
							
							elementfi: Switch all presets to compile-only  
						
						
						
					 
					
						2022-04-01 23:06:21 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							5ef0048d85 
							
						 
					 
					
						
						
							
							zeppelin: Disable the newly added Polygon-Child test, failing via IR due to Hardhat heuristics  
						
						
						
					 
					
						2022-04-01 23:06:21 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							b445e7e74c 
							
						 
					 
					
						
						
							
							Revert "perpetual-pools: Use Hardhat 2.8.4 to work around @openzeppelin/hardhat-upgrades's problem with parallel compilation on Hardhat 2.9.0"  
						
						... 
						
						
						
						This reverts commit 30008465bf 
						
					 
					
						2022-03-28 19:51:46 +02: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							34c06c27a5 
							
						 
					 
					
						
						
							
							Downgrade ethers.js to 5.6.1 in ens, gnosis, euler, perpetual-pools and uniswap external tests  
						
						
						
					 
					
						2022-03-28 17:56:30 +02:00 
						 
				 
			
				
					
						
							
							
								Daniel Kirchner 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							26963775fe 
							
						 
					 
					
						
						
							
							Merge pull request  #12736  from ethereum/reenable-tests-via-ir-in-ext-tests  
						
						... 
						
						
						
						Re-enable running tests via IR in external tests in cases where they don't pass due to Hardhat heuristics 
						
					 
					
						2022-03-11 13:44:55 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							b5caa77482 
							
						 
					 
					
						
						
							
							euler: Use project's own TEST_TIMEOUT var for changing the timeout instead of mocha settings  
						
						
						
					 
					
						2022-03-10 14:52:51 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							e9f3f9361d 
							
						 
					 
					
						
						
							
							Re-enable running tests in external tests via IR in cases where they don't pass due to Hardhat heuristics  
						
						
						
					 
					
						2022-03-10 14:13:00 +01:00 
						 
				 
			
				
					
						
							
							
								Daniel Kirchner 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							794752c649 
							
						 
					 
					
						
						
							
							Merge pull request  #12765  from ethereum/euler-timeout-fix  
						
						... 
						
						
						
						Increase Hardhat timeout in Euler ext test 
						
					 
					
						2022-03-10 13:15:59 +01:00 
						 
				 
			
				
					
						
							
							
								chriseth 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							eff76f0f82 
							
						 
					 
					
						
						
							
							Merge pull request  #12195  from ethereum/update-gnosis-ext-test  
						
						... 
						
						
						
						Run GnosisSafe external tests with Hardhat and directly on upstream 
						
					 
					
						2022-03-10 08:42:11 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							9ef600e572 
							
						 
					 
					
						
						
							
							euler: Override Hardhat test timeout  
						
						
						
					 
					
						2022-03-09 20:37:08 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							304c3984ad 
							
						 
					 
					
						
						
							
							Update gnosis external test to use upstream directly and use Hardhat  
						
						
						
					 
					
						2022-03-09 19:57:16 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							68bdb7f2e0 
							
						 
					 
					
						
						
							
							Disable flaky ElementFi tests  
						
						
						
					 
					
						2022-03-09 18:58:02 +01:00 
						 
				 
			
				
					
						
							
							
								chriseth 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							4f19d68ee9 
							
						 
					 
					
						
						
							
							Merge pull request  #12620  from ethereum/assemblyAnnotation  
						
						... 
						
						
						
						Memory-safety annotation for inline assembly. 
						
					 
					
						2022-03-07 12:48:41 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							30008465bf 
							
						 
					 
					
						
						
							
							perpetual-pools: Use Hardhat 2.8.4 to work around @openzeppelin/hardhat-upgrades's problem with parallel compilation on Hardhat 2.9.0  
						
						
						
					 
					
						2022-03-02 16:47:55 +01:00 
						 
				 
			
				
					
						
							
							
								Daniel Kirchner 
							
						 
					 
					
						
						
						
						
							
						
						
							ad13062978 
							
						 
					 
					
						
						
							
							Patch external tests with a safe inline assembly annotation.  
						
						
						
					 
					
						2022-03-02 16:42:28 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							8aa3b7fea0 
							
						 
					 
					
						
						
							
							Neutralize packaged Uniswap contracts in yield-liquidator external test  
						
						
						
					 
					
						2022-02-16 13:16:44 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							ccbc865beb 
							
						 
					 
					
						
						
							
							elementfi: Bypass expiration check that won't pass due to test settings  
						
						
						
					 
					
						2022-02-15 12:51:40 +01:00 
						 
				 
			
				
					
						
							
							
								Leo 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							947a599e91 
							
						 
					 
					
						
						
							
							Merge pull request  #12441  from ethereum/benchmarking-ext-tests  
						
						... 
						
						
						
						Benchmarking external tests 
						
					 
					
						2022-02-14 20:14:27 +01:00 
						 
				 
			
				
					
						
							
							
								Leo 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							3915768753 
							
						 
					 
					
						
						
							
							Merge pull request  #12594  from ethereum/solc-js-ext-test-local-checkout  
						
						... 
						
						
						
						solc-js external test on a local checkout 
						
					 
					
						2022-02-14 19:44:46 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							c6094bb0c2 
							
						 
					 
					
						
						
							
							externalTests: Benchmark reports  
						
						
						
					 
					
						2022-02-09 17:02:40 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							7fc2253841 
							
						 
					 
					
						
						
							
							externalTests: Make comments about failing presets less terse  
						
						
						
					 
					
						2022-02-09 17:02:40 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							3e1aee1745 
							
						 
					 
					
						
						
							
							externalTests: Clean the build/ dir for Hardhat too  
						
						
						
					 
					
						2022-02-09 17:02:40 +01:00 
						 
				 
			
				
					
						
							
							
								chriseth 
							
						 
					 
					
						
						
						
						
							
						
						
							4715fafb82 
							
						 
					 
					
						
						
							
							Re-enable preset for poolTogether.  
						
						
						
					 
					
						2022-02-07 11:31:59 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
							
							
						
						
						
							
						
						
							32d64ce666 
							
						 
					 
					
						
						
							
							Merge pull request  #12630  from ethereum/enable-full-tests-in-prb-math-ext-test  
						
						... 
						
						
						
						Enable full tests in PRBMath external test 
						
					 
					
						2022-02-04 16:56:31 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							4ebd839d3a 
							
						 
					 
					
						
						
							
							Run full tests, not just test:contracts in PRBMath external test  
						
						... 
						
						
						
						- `test:contracts` does not seem to be running any tests at all. 
						
					 
					
						2022-02-04 15:51:34 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							b52032a452 
							
						 
					 
					
						
						
							
							Re-enable Bleeps and just disable the failing governor test  
						
						
						
					 
					
						2022-02-04 15:18:37 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							9e641e60e7 
							
						 
					 
					
						
						
							
							externalTests/solc-js: Allow using a local checkout of solc-js  
						
						
						
					 
					
						2022-02-04 15:05:00 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							b925250705 
							
						 
					 
					
						
						
							
							Make solc-js.sh run its tests directly  
						
						... 
						
						
						
						- Its structure has diverged a lot from other external tests and there's not point in keeping it abstracted like this. 
						
					 
					
						2022-02-04 15:05:00 +01:00 
						 
				 
			
				
					
						
							
							
								Kamil Śliwak 
							
						 
					 
					
						
						
						
						
							
						
						
							f5b345504b 
							
						 
					 
					
						
						
							
							When installing solc-js use the dist/ subdir, which contains the built JS files  
						
						
						
					 
					
						2022-02-03 18:47:19 +01:00